Transaction 23cccb3cb19d67c2a1fda3b815f2c557450e3099a01349d04574404c179fcd4e
1 Input
1 Output
-
23cccb3cb19d67c2a1fda3b815f2c557450e3099a01349d04574404c179fcd4e:0
- value
- 757246
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ecc0b64865b4d32c136df0f4f9705376c1aa35fe
- address
- bc1qanqtvjr9knfjcymd7r60juznwmq65d07jzwg54